Used / Pre-owned — sold for spares, repair, or display/prop use only. Unit has no power and cannot be used as a functioning monitor in its current state. Condition is as shown in images — please refer to all photos before purchasing.

A Compaq V500 14-inch CRT monitor dating from March 1999, in the classic late-1990s beige/off-white housing with the distinctive curved front bezel and stepped top profile characteristic of the era. Rear label details (photo-verified):

  • Model No.: PE111B
  • Serial No.: 8i0BJ11AJ001
  • Manufactured: March 1999
  • Input: 100–240V, 50–60Hz, 1.8A
  • Compaq Computer Corporation, Houston, Texas, USA

Known faults / condition issues (photo-verified):

  • No power — unit does not power on; fault unknown
  • VGA cable cut — the VGA signal cable has been cut close to the rear housing, leaving a short stub with exposed wires; not usable for signal connection without repair
  • Housing crack — a significant horizontal split/crack runs across the top rear panel of the housing, with the plastic lifted and separated; clearly visible in photos
  • Stand missing — the tilt/swivel stand base is absent; monitor sits flat without it
  • Scuffs and scratches — general age yellowing and scuff marks to the beige plastic throughout, particularly on the front bezel and sides

What appears intact (photo-verified):

  • CRT screen face — no visible cracks to the tube face
  • IEC C13 power inlet on the rear — socket appears intact (no power cable included)
  • Overall housing structure is intact aside from the top panel crack

What is not included: power cable, VGA cable (cut), stand.
